How to Choose the Best WAN Networking
Prioritizing Multi-WAN Capabilities and Redundancy
When selecting a WAN networking solution, the ability to utilize multiple internet connections simultaneously is a critical factor for ensuring uptime and optimizing bandwidth. Devices like the TP-Link ER605 V2 stand out by offering up to three WAN Ethernet ports, plus an additional USB WAN port for mobile broadband backup. This configuration allows for load balancing across different ISPs, distributing traffic efficiently, or providing failover in case one connection drops. In practice, users report that such redundancy is invaluable for business continuity. Without robust multi-WAN options, a single point of failure can disrupt operations, highlighting why solutions offering diverse WAN input, similar to what TP-Link provides, are often preferred for critical applications.
Evaluating Advanced Security Features
Network security is paramount in WAN environments, where data traverses various public and private networks. A comprehensive WAN solution must incorporate advanced security protocols to protect against threats. The TP-Link ER605 V2, for instance, includes an SPI Firewall, DoS defense, and IP/MAC/URL filtering, which are fundamental for safeguarding network perimeters. While devices like the TP-Link Archer BE600 focus on advanced Wi-Fi security with features like HomeShield, a dedicated WAN router's security suite is often more extensive for external threats. Organizations considering a Cisco SD-WAN approach, as detailed in various guides, often integrate security directly into their WAN architecture, making features like VPNs and deep packet inspection standard requirements.

Management and Scalability for Distributed Networks
For businesses with multiple branches or a growing network, centralized management and scalability are key considerations. Solutions integrated with Software-Defined Networking (SDN), such as TP-Link's Omada SDN platform, simplify the deployment, configuration, and monitoring of multiple devices from a single interface. This contrasts with traditional, device-by-device management, which becomes cumbersome with scale. Concepts explored in Cisco SD-WAN literature emphasize the benefits of software-defined approaches for orchestrating complex WANs, enabling dynamic path selection and simplified policy enforcement across distributed sites. When evaluating options, consider how easily new devices can be added, how policies are applied, and the level of visibility provided across the entire WAN infrastructure.

Common Mistakes to Avoid
Underestimating Multi-WAN Port Requirements
A common oversight is failing to adequately plan for internet redundancy and load balancing. Businesses often purchase a single-WAN router, only to discover later that they need multiple ISPs for failover or increased aggregate bandwidth. For instance, overlooking the advantage of a device like the TP-Link ER605 V2 with its 'up to 3 WAN Ethernet ports plus 1 USB WAN' can lead to significant network downtime if a primary internet connection fails. Users typically report that having diverse WAN options prevents costly operational interruptions.
